Love Marriages

People often ask me if love marriages work. The answer is a little complicated, but the short answer is yes, they can work.

There are a few things to consider when looking at whether or not a love marriage will work. The most important factor is the commitment of both parties. If both people are committed to each other, then a love marriage can work.

Another important factor is communication. If both parties are able to communicate well, then they will be able to handle any problems that may arise.

The last factor to consider is the compatibility of the two parties. If the two parties are compatible, then they are likely to have a successful love marriage.

Factors for Successful Love Marriages

I believe that love marriages work because they are built on trust, compromise and communication. The key to a successful love marriage is to build trust between the couple and to have a mutual understanding of each other’s needs and wants. Communication is key in any relationship and in a love marriage, it is even more important. Couples must be able to compromise and work together to make both their lives happier.
